Hospital Adoption Policies

By The Staff at AGoHA, 6/29/07

Hospitals all have different policies about adoption. Some are very rigid and some are very accommodating. If we have worked with the hospital before, we can tell you a little about what to expect, however, there is a fair amount of unpredictability. What to Take to the Hospital

By The Staff at AGoHA, 6/16/07
